Definition of tinware - Reverso English Dictionary

Noun

metal itemsRareUSarticles made of tin or covered with tinRareUS
  • The kitchen cupboard was filled with various pieces of tinware.
  • She inherited a collection of antique tinware from her grandmother.
  • The market stall displayed handmade tinware.

Origin of tinware

Old English, tin (tin) + ware (goods)
